Why it stands out
The 2017 Kia Forte stands out as a heavily refreshed compact sedan that Kia used to keep the car competitive in a crowded segment. For 2017, it received a restyled front end, new lights front and back, a more efficient 2.0-liter engine, a sport trim, and more standard features across the lineup.
That combination makes the Forte appealing to buyers who want a compact sedan that feels updated without moving up to a larger or pricier vehicle. Its strengths are the breadth of the refresh and the added equipment, while its challenge is the same one faced by any car in this class: it has to hold its own against a long list of rivals.

Is the 2017 Kia Forte a good car?
With a 3.25/5 user rating and a 7.33/10 expert rating, the 2017 Forte lands in the solid-but-selective-buy category rather than the standout-everywhere tier.
The model scores 8/10 across Form and function, Cost effectiveness, and Safety.
The 2017 refresh gives you a restyled front end, new lights front and back, a more efficient 2.0-liter engine, a sport trim, and more standard features across the lineup. That makes it a sensible fit if you want a compact sedan that feels updated without moving up to a larger or pricier vehicle.

Is the 2017 Kia Forte reliable?
The 2017 Forte is presented as a refreshed compact sedan with a more efficient 2.0-liter engine and a lineup that was updated to stay competitive in a crowded segment.
The expert evaluation also points to a car that delivers enough power for everyday use without feeling strained, while noting that the suspension can get busy over rough pavement when you push it. That suggests the mechanical package is competent, but not especially polished.
Kia’s long warranty reputation and the model’s strong cost-effectiveness case help support the ownership picture, especially if you want a well-equipped compact sedan without stretching your budget. For used buyers, the main long-term risk is buying a neglected example that has been driven hard or skipped routine care.
What should I look for when buying a used 2017 Kia Forte?
At 47.6% accident-free, a meaningful share of listings has prior incidents — history verification is especially important.
You should start with a vehicle-history report and then prioritize a pre-purchase inspection, especially if the car has been in a collision or has higher mileage. Focus on body-panel alignment, paint consistency, tire wear, and how the car tracks and brakes on a test drive.
Key things to evaluate:
- Trim level: The base LX is the most stripped-down version, with a small 4.3-inch touchscreen and a basic 4-speaker stereo, while S trims add a 7-inch touchscreen with Apple CarPlay and Android Auto plus more standard equipment. The EX adds more comfort and convenience content, and the higher trims are the ones that make the Forte feel more complete.
- Powertrain: The updated 2.0-liter engine makes 147 horsepower and 132 pound-feet of torque, with EPA estimates of 29 mpg city and 38 mpg highway for 32 mpg combined. The base LX manual drops to 25/34 mpg and 28 combined, while the EX’s carryover 2.0-liter setup is rated at 25/33 mpg.
- Safety package: The available safety suite includes lane-departure warning and prevention, blind-spot monitoring with rear cross-traffic alert, and forward-collision warning with auto brake and pedestrian detection. Those features are available above the base LX, so you should verify whether a specific listing has the package you want.
- Infotainment: The base LX uses a 4.3-inch touchscreen, while S trims and above get a 7-inch touchscreen with Kia’s UVO infotainment system and Apple CarPlay and Android Auto. The upgraded color LCD screen between the gauges in the EX is a nice extra, but it is not the main reason to move up.
- Fuel efficiency: The updated 2.0-liter engine is rated at 29 mpg city and 38 mpg highway with 32 mpg combined, while the base LX manual is rated at 25/34 mpg and 28 combined. The EX is rated at 25/33 mpg.
Which 2017 Kia Forte trim should I buy?
The 2017 Kia Forte is offered in 3 trim levels: LX, S, EX.
Here's the short version:
- LX: This is the entry point, but it is very bare-bones unless you add packages. It makes sense only if you want the lowest purchase price and are willing to give up a lot of convenience and tech.
- S: This is the best-value trim because it adds the 7-inch touchscreen,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, selectable drive modes, sport suspension, unique trim and upholstery, and 16-inch alloy wheels. It gives you the strongest mix of equipment and price without pushing you into the most expensive version.
- EX: This is the comfort-oriented choice if you want more upscale features, including the upgraded color LCD meter cluster and available heated power seats with ventilation, navigation, and other premium touches. It suits you best if you care more about comfort and convenience than the sportier setup of the S.
The safety systems are available above the base LX, so if those features matter to you, make sure the listing you choose includes the right package.

Is the 2017 Kia Forte safe?
The Forte earns five-star ratings from NHTSA overall, with a four-star rating in overall front impact tests.
It earns a 8/10 safety score from our experts.
The available safety suite includes lane-departure warning and prevention, blind-spot monitoring with rear cross-traffic alert, and forward-collision warning with auto brake and pedestrian detection. Those systems are available above the base LX, so you should confirm that a specific used listing includes the package you want.
The front-impact result is the main caveat to keep in mind, even though the overall government rating is strong. If safety is a top priority, look for a car with the full driver-assistance package and verify that all systems work properly.

Who Makes Kia Cars?
Kia is a Korean automaker that makes a full line of cars, SUVs, and electric vehicles. Hyundai is its parent company, owning roughly 34% of Kia. Like Hyundai, Kia vehicles are highly competitive in their respective vehicle segments and offer shoppers a value buy in many segments.
